Eligibility Requirements for Online Renewal
Before proceeding with the online transaction, it is crucial to verify that you meet the specific eligibility criteria established by the Virginia DMV. Not every situation qualifies for digital renewal, and understanding these restrictions prevents frustration later in the process. Generally, the option is available to eligible Virginia residents whose current registration is valid or expired for a short period. Meeting these requirements ensures a smooth transition to the next steps of the online portal.
Your vehicle registration must be eligible for renewal by mail or online.
Your driver’s license or ID must be valid, suspended, or expired for less than one year.
Your vehicle must be a personal automobile, motorcycle, or commercial vehicle under specific weight limits.
You must not have any outstanding safety or emissions inspection requirements.

Required Personal and Vehicle Information
Accessing the Virginia DMV online services page requires your personal identification details to verify your identity. You will need your current driver’s license number or state ID number to log into the secure portal. Additionally, having your vehicle identification number (VIN) and the current registration certificate readily available is necessary to complete the transaction. This information links your identity to the vehicle and confirms your eligibility for the renewal cycle.

Payment and Confirmation
Once your information is verified, the system directs you to the payment gateway where you can submit the applicable renewal fee. Virginia accepts major credit and debit cards for this secure transaction, providing a convenient end to the process. After the payment is processed, you will receive a confirmation page and email receipt detailing the transaction. This digital proof serves as your temporary registration until the physical tags arrive in the mail within the designated timeframe.
